Transaction 44cc6976a6b18d4c3ee39579ea5031f019fe2b7757967ba21ab3c95195a37f12
1 Input
2 Outputs
- 44cc6976a6b18d4c3ee39579ea5031f019fe2b7757967ba21ab3c95195a37f12:0
- 44cc6976a6b18d4c3ee39579ea5031f019fe2b7757967ba21ab3c95195a37f12:1
value 7008
address 19HxZxnc9FsC9qhBtsPmBHw4cx1pCKLxcm
value 660000
address 13nnJaXsgaoTHCDHJ1ZVDzbCNrSFaZ4gs3